Package: samba4
Version: 4.0.0~beta2+dfsg1-3.2+deb7u2
The samba4 package is missing.
...
# aptitude install -y samba4
No candidate version found for samba4
No candidate version found for samba4
No packages will be installed, upgraded, or removed.
0 packages up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
Need to get 0 B of archives. After unpacking 0 B will be used.
...
my sources.list refers to
wheezy, wheezy/updates, wheezy-updates
main contrib
--- End Message ---
--- Begin Message ---
That is correct; Samba 4 was removed from stable.
See http://bugs.debian.org/744711
